Freda came down from the moors and became encamped in the field next to mine. She stayed their for about eighteen months. When my shearer was due to arrive, I became concerned about this sheep and she had at least two years growth of fleece. I knew if she went back on the moors she would never survive, her fleece was too thick and when wet would prove too heavy for her to walk. I decided to entice her onto my patch, that didn't take too much effort and she joined my crew. When the shearer arrive she to was treated to a trim. I am sure she felt much better and she has been with me ever since. As I freed her from the other field and her enormous fleece, that became her name!!
